I have a customer that after the 12.5 upgrade, noticed the phone display during a call, will now display:
Joe Smith...
For: XXXX - Jane Smith
They would like to have it continue to display the extension that called. I have been unable to find in enterprise phone configuration where I can change this, or even if I can.

IF you set alerting name and caller-ID as name + extension it should display the name with extension.
04-13-2021 10:44 PM
If you don’t want to display the defined name of the calling end don’t configure anything in the display and alert fields, keeping all 4 of them empty should display the directory number when you make a call. Line text label that is referenced in another answer is irrelevant to this. It just sets what to show on the display of the phone for the directory number, it’s not at play for calls as such.
